package org.apache.hadoop.test;
import org.junit.Test;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import java.util.function.Supplier;
import org.slf4j.event.Level;
import static org.junit.Assert.assertEquals;
import static org.junit.Assert.assertTrue;
import static org.junit.Assert.fail;
public class TestGenericTestUtils extends GenericTestUtils {
@Test
public void testAssertExceptionContainsNullEx() throws Throwable {
try {
assertExceptionContains("", null);
} catch (AssertionError e) {
if (!e.toString().contains(E_NULL_THROWABLE)) {
throw e;
}
}
}
@Test
public void testAssertExceptionContainsNullString() throws Throwable {
try {
assertExceptionContains("", new BrokenException());
} catch (AssertionError e) {
if (!e.toString().contains(E_NULL_THROWABLE_STRING)) {
throw e;
}
}
}
@Test
public void testAssertExceptionContainsWrongText() throws Throwable {
try {
assertExceptionContains("Expected", new Exception("(actual)"));
} catch (AssertionError e) {
String s = e.toString();
if (!s.contains(E_UNEXPECTED_EXCEPTION)
|| !s.contains("(actual)") ) {
throw e;
}
if (e.getCause() == null) {
throw new AssertionError("No nested cause in assertion", e);
}
}
}
@Test
public void testAssertExceptionContainsWorking() throws Throwable {
assertExceptionContains("Expected", new Exception("Expected"));
}
private static class BrokenException extends Exception {
public BrokenException() {
}
@Override
public String toString() {
return null;
}
}
@Test(timeout = 10000)
public void testLogCapturer() {
final Logger log = LoggerFactory.getLogger(TestGenericTestUtils.class);
LogCapturer logCapturer = LogCapturer.captureLogs(log);
final String infoMessage = "info message";
// test get output message
log.info(infoMessage);
assertTrue(logCapturer.getOutput().endsWith(
String.format(infoMessage + "%n")));
// test clear output
logCapturer.clearOutput();
assertTrue(logCapturer.getOutput().isEmpty());
// test stop capturing
logCapturer.stopCapturing();
log.info(infoMessage);
assertTrue(logCapturer.getOutput().isEmpty());
}
@Test(timeout = 10000)
public void testLogCapturerSlf4jLogger() {
final Logger logger = LoggerFactory.getLogger(TestGenericTestUtils.class);
LogCapturer logCapturer = LogCapturer.captureLogs(logger);
final String infoMessage = "info message";
// test get output message
logger.info(infoMessage);
assertTrue(logCapturer.getOutput().endsWith(
String.format(infoMessage + "%n")));
// test clear output
logCapturer.clearOutput();
assertTrue(logCapturer.getOutput().isEmpty());
// test stop capturing
logCapturer.stopCapturing();
logger.info(infoMessage);
assertTrue(logCapturer.getOutput().isEmpty());
}
@Test
public void testWaitingForConditionWithInvalidParams() throws Throwable {
// test waitFor method with null supplier interface
try {
waitFor(null, 0, 0);
} catch (NullPointerException e) {
assertExceptionContains(GenericTestUtils.ERROR_MISSING_ARGUMENT, e);
}
Supplier<Boolean> simpleSupplier = new Supplier<Boolean>() {
@Override
public Boolean get() {
return true;
}
};
// test waitFor method with waitForMillis greater than checkEveryMillis
waitFor(simpleSupplier, 5, 10);
try {
// test waitFor method with waitForMillis smaller than checkEveryMillis
waitFor(simpleSupplier, 10, 5);
fail(
"Excepted a failure when the param value of"
+ " waitForMillis is smaller than checkEveryMillis.");
} catch (IllegalArgumentException e) {
assertExceptionContains(GenericTestUtils.ERROR_INVALID_ARGUMENT, e);
}
}
@Test
public void testToLevel() throws Throwable {
assertEquals(Level.INFO, toLevel("INFO"));
assertEquals(Level.DEBUG, toLevel("NonExistLevel"));
assertEquals(Level.INFO, toLevel("INFO", Level.TRACE));
assertEquals(Level.TRACE, toLevel("NonExistLevel", Level.TRACE));
}
}
